Jerome Lewis

Jerome Lewis enters the 2017 season as his first year with Methodist working with the tight ends and half backs.

Prior to Methodist, Lewis played the 2016 season with the Billings Wolves helping them to their first Indoor Football League playoff berth.

Lewis started his college playing career in 2010 with Virginia Tech, where he was a member of the 2010 ACC Championship team. He later finished his college career at Akron helping rebuild the Zips football program.

In high school, Lewis was member of the SuperPrep Northeast Team and was listed as the No. 21 tight end in the country and the No. 3 player in the state of New York by Rivals and Scout.com. He was also named to the PrepStar’s All-Big East Team as a defensive lineman before earning a 2009 SuperPrep Preseason All-America nod. Lewis was also invited to play as a tight end in the 2010 Offense-Defense All-American Bowl, which was played in Myrtle Beach.
